DCL Launches Emissions Control Solution for European Data Center Backup Power
DCL has introduced a new emissions control system for diesel and HVO engines in data center backup power across Europe. Utilizing the Metalcor® catalyst technology, the solution enables faster thermal activation and significantly reduces NOx emissions during short engine operation. It also includes oxidation catalysts and particulate control technologies to address various emissions. The compact design supports space-constrained environments and is sustainable with rechargeable substrates, enhancing lifecycle value. The system is available in various configurations for new installations and retrofits.
